Imaginez la situation d'un site e-commerce qui voit son trafic chuter de moitié en l'espace d'une nuit, la cause étant un temps de chargement trop long. Ou encore, pensez aux conséquences désastreuses pour une entreprise dont la réputation est ternie par une faille de sécurité ayant compromis les informations personnelles de sa clientèle. Heureusement, ces scénarios, bien que graves, peuvent être évités grâce à un allié simple et efficace : l'audit technique.
Dans l'environnement numérique actuel, caractérisé par une concurrence acharnée et des utilisateurs toujours plus exigeants, un site web performant et protégé représente bien plus qu'un simple outil de communication : il est un pilier essentiel du succès de toute organisation. À l'image d'un bâtiment nécessitant un entretien régulier pour prévenir les dégradations structurelles, une plateforme web requiert un "check-up" périodique afin d'identifier et corriger les points faibles susceptibles de compromettre son fonctionnement optimal.
Pourquoi un audit technique est-il indispensable ?
L'audit technique est plus qu'une simple vérification routinière ; il s'agit d'un investissement judicieux qui vous préserve contre les pertes financières, les dommages à votre image et les diminutions de trafic. C'est un examen approfondi de chaque aspect technique de votre site, de sa vélocité à sa sûreté, sans oublier son optimisation pour les moteurs de recherche et l'expérience utilisateur qu'il propose. Cette analyse minutieuse dévoile les zones de fragilité qui pourraient nuire à sa bonne marche et permet de mettre en place les ajustements nécessaires pour les corriger.
Performance accrue
Un site lent, c'est un site qui perd des clients. Selon une étude de Google, 53% des internautes abandonnent une page mobile si celle-ci met plus de trois secondes à se charger. Un audit technique permet de localiser les éléments qui freinent votre site et de déployer des solutions pour augmenter sa rapidité. Par exemple, l'optimisation des visuels, la réduction de la taille du code CSS et JavaScript, et l'exploitation de la mise en cache peuvent dynamiser de manière significative la performance de votre plateforme.
- Temps de chargement amélioré : Un diagnostic identifie et rectifie les ralentissements, boostant l'UX, abaissant le taux de rebond et propulsant votre SEO.
- Optimisation des ressources : La compression des visuels, la minification du code et l'usage du cache réduisent la consommation de la bande passante et les dépenses d'hébergement.
- Scalabilité : Un bilan s'assure que votre site supporte les pics de trafic sans impacter sa performance, crucial pour les e-commerces lors des promotions.
Amélioration du SEO
Une plateforme optimisée pour les moteurs de recherche attire un trafic organique plus conséquent. L'audit technique permet d'examiner l'architecture de votre site, son contenu, ses balises méta et son maillage interne pour s'assurer qu'il est facilement indexé par les moteurs de recherche et qu'il répond aux critères de pertinence de Google, améliorant ainsi le SEO.
- Indexation facilitée : Un diagnostic assure que les robots d'exploration des moteurs de recherche accèdent facilement à votre contenu. L'optimisation du sitemap et du fichier robots.txt est essentielle pour une bonne indexation.
- Optimisation pour le mobile : Avec l'indexation "mobile-first" de Google, une conception adaptative et une vitesse de chargement rapide sur mobile sont cruciales.
- Structure du site : Une architecture transparente facilite la navigation des visiteurs et l'indexation par les moteurs de recherche. Un maillage interne optimisé renforce l'autorité des pages de votre site.
Sécurité renforcée
La sécurité de votre site est primordiale, pour protéger vos données et garantir la confiance de vos clients. L'audit technique identifie les vulnérabilités et met en place des mesures pour les corriger. La mise à jour régulière de votre CMS et plugins, l'installation d'un certificat SSL et la protection contre les attaques XSS et les injections SQL sont des mesures essentielles. Par exemple, un audit de sécurité peut révéler des failles exploitables par des attaques de type Cross-Site Scripting (XSS), où des scripts malveillants sont injectés dans votre site pour voler des données ou rediriger vos utilisateurs vers des pages frauduleuses. En identifiant et en corrigeant ces failles, vous protégez vos visiteurs et votre réputation.
- Vulnérabilités potentielles : Un audit décèle et corrige les failles de sécurité, telles que les injections SQL et le cross-site scripting (XSS).
- Certificat SSL : Le protocole HTTPS est indispensable pour la sûreté des données des utilisateurs et la crédibilité auprès des moteurs de recherche.
- Mises à jour des CMS et plugins : La maintenance à jour de vos logiciels corrige les brèches de sécurité connues. Les CMS obsolètes sont des cibles faciles.
Expérience utilisateur optimisée (UX)
Un site web avec une excellente expérience utilisateur fidélise ses visiteurs et booste ses conversions. L'audit technique analyse la navigation, l'ergonomie, l'accessibilité et la compatibilité multi-navigateurs et multi-appareils pour offrir une expérience optimale.
- Navigation intuitive : Une navigation aisée guide les utilisateurs vers ce qu'ils recherchent rapidement. Un test utilisateur peut révéler des problèmes d'ergonomie.
- Compatibilité multi-navigateurs et multi-appareils : Assurez-vous que votre site fonctionne impeccablement sur tous les navigateurs et appareils courants. Le responsive design est indispensable pour toucher tous vos prospects.
- Accessibilité : Un site accessible est un impératif éthique et une exigence légale dans certains territoires. La conformité aux WCAG (Web Content Accessibility Guidelines) est une garantie d'inclusion.
Réduction des coûts à long terme
Investir dans un audit technique semble coûteux, mais c'est un placement qui génère des économies sur le long terme. En corrigeant les problèmes mineurs avant qu'ils ne s'aggravent, vous évitez des réparations onéreuses, optimisez les performances, et diminuez les coûts d'hébergement et de bande passante. De plus, une plateforme performante améliore le taux de conversion et augmente les revenus, améliorant ainsi le retour sur investissement.
Type d'audit | Objectifs | Impacts | Fréquence recommandée |
---|---|---|---|
Performance | Accélérer le temps de chargement, réduire la consommation de ressources | Amélioration de l'UX, réduction du taux de rebond, meilleur SEO | Trimestrielle |
SEO | Booster le positionnement dans les résultats de recherche, attirer plus de trafic | Augmentation du trafic, visibilité accrue, conversions améliorées | Semestrielle |
Sécurité | Détecter et corriger les vulnérabilités, protéger les données | Prévention des attaques, protection de la réputation, conformité | Continue |
Accessibilité | Rendre le site accessible, respecter les normes WCAG | Conformité légale, inclusion, meilleure UX pour tous | Annuelle |
Les différents aspects d'un audit technique
L'audit technique est un processus qui englobe de nombreux aspects de votre site web. Il est primordial de comprendre ces composantes clés pour appréhender efficacement l'audit et appliquer les correctifs appropriés. Chaque élément, de la performance à l'accessibilité, joue un rôle essentiel dans la santé globale de votre site.
Audit de la performance
Cet audit évalue la vitesse de chargement et identifie les éléments qui freinent votre site. Des outils comme Google PageSpeed Insights, GTmetrix et WebPageTest analysent les temps de chargement, la taille des fichiers et la consommation de ressources. L'objectif est d'optimiser la rapidité et l'efficience de votre site web.
- Tests de vitesse de chargement : Outils comme Google PageSpeed Insights, GTmetrix, WebPageTest sont à privilégier. Un score PageSpeed Insights supérieur à 80 est un bon indicateur.
- Analyse des ressources : Identification des fichiers volumineux et des scripts gourmands. Souvent, les images représentent une part importante du poids d'une page.
- Optimisation du code : Minification du code HTML, CSS et JavaScript est à réaliser. La suppression du code inutile accélère le chargement.
- Hébergement : Une analyse de la performance de l'hébergement est essentielle. Un serveur lent impacte fortement la vitesse du site.
Audit SEO
L'audit SEO examine les éléments qui influencent le positionnement dans les résultats de recherche, incluant l'analyse des mots-clés, de la structure, du contenu, des liens et des données structurées. Il a pour but d'améliorer la visibilité et d'attirer un trafic organique plus important sur votre site web, en améliorant votre stratégie de mots-clés et votre structure de site.
- Analyse des mots-clés : Identification des mots-clés cibles et de la position dans les résultats. Google Search Console et SEMrush sont des outils recommandés.
- Analyse de la structure du site : Vérification de la navigation, du maillage interne et de l'architecture. Une structure claire facilite l'indexation.
- Analyse du contenu : Vérification de la qualité, pertinence et originalité du contenu. L'optimisation des balises titres et méta descriptions est cruciale.
- Analyse des liens : Vérification des liens internes et externes. Identifier les liens brisés évite de nuire à l'UX et au SEO.
- Analyse des données structurées (Schema Markup) : Implémentation correcte des données structurées pour une meilleure visibilité.
Audit de sécurité
L'audit de sécurité vise à identifier les vulnérabilités et à mettre en place des protections pour les corriger. Il comprend des tests de vulnérabilité, l'analyse du code, la vérification des certificats SSL et l'analyse des journaux du serveur. Son objectif est de protéger votre site contre les menaces et de garantir la protection des données. Par exemple, l'analyse des journaux du serveur peut révéler des tentatives d'intrusion par force brute, où des pirates essaient d'accéder à votre site en testant un grand nombre de combinaisons de nom d'utilisateur et de mot de passe. En surveillant ces journaux et en mettant en place des mesures de sécurité appropriées, vous pouvez contrer ces attaques et protéger votre site contre les accès non autorisés.
- Tests de vulnérabilité : Utilisation d'outils de sécurité pour identifier les failles. Les tests d'intrusion simulent des attaques pour déceler les points faibles.
- Analyse du code : Recherche de code malveillant et de vulnérabilités. L'analyse statique identifie les problèmes de sécurité avant exploitation.
- Vérification des certificats SSL : Assurer la validité et la configuration des certificats SSL. Un certificat expiré compromet la protection des données.
- Analyse des journaux du serveur : Recherche d'activités suspectes. L'analyse des journaux détecte les intrusions et les activités malveillantes.
- Gestion des accès : Vérification des permissions et des rôles des utilisateurs. Des permissions excessives peuvent compromettre la sécurité.
Audit d'accessibilité
L'audit d'accessibilité cherche à rendre votre site accessible à tous. Il inclut la vérification du respect des normes WCAG (Web Content Accessibility Guidelines), l'usage d'outils d'audit et des tests utilisateurs avec des personnes handicapées. Un exemple concret d'amélioration de l'accessibilité est l'ajout d'attributs "alt" descriptifs à toutes les images de votre site. Ces attributs permettent aux personnes malvoyantes utilisant des lecteurs d'écran de comprendre le contenu des images. De plus, ils améliorent le SEO de votre site en fournissant aux moteurs de recherche un contexte supplémentaire sur vos images.
- Respect des normes WCAG : Vérification de la conformité aux recommandations pour un contenu web accessible.
- Utilisation d'outils d'audit : Outils comme WAVE et axe DevTools sont à privilégier pour identifier les problèmes.
- Tests utilisateurs avec des personnes handicapées : Recueillir des retours concrets est essentiel pour améliorer l'accessibilité.
Audit du code
L'audit du code examine la qualité et la structure du code source, évaluant la lisibilité, la maintenabilité, le respect des standards et recherchant les erreurs. Il a pour but d'améliorer la qualité du code, facilitant sa maintenance et son évolution. En effet, un code mal structuré peut entraîner des bugs difficiles à corriger, des problèmes de performance et des failles de sécurité. En effectuant un audit régulier de votre code et en le refactorisant si nécessaire, vous vous assurez que votre site reste stable, performant et sécurisé sur le long terme.
- Qualité du code : Lisibilité, maintenabilité, respect des standards sont à évaluer. Un code clair est plus facile à comprendre et à maintenir.
- Erreurs de code : Recherche et correction des erreurs qui peuvent impacter la performance et la sécurité.
- Analyse de la dette technique : Identification des zones du code qui nécessitent une refactorisation pour le bon fonctionnement.
Comment réaliser un audit technique ?
Pour réaliser un audit technique, vous avez deux options : faire appel à un expert ou le faire vous-même. Le choix dépend de vos compétences, de votre budget et de vos besoins.
Faire appel à un expert
Confier l'audit à un professionnel expérimenté offre l'avantage de bénéficier de son savoir-faire, de ses outils et de ses compétences pour un diagnostic complet. Toutefois, cette option est plus coûteuse que de le faire vous-même. Lors du choix d'un expert, recherchez des certifications reconnues comme celles délivrées par des organisations spécialisées en sécurité web ou en optimisation SEO. Ces certifications attestent du niveau de compétence et d'expertise du professionnel.
- Avantages et inconvénients : L'expertise est un atout, mais le coût est un frein potentiel.
- Choisir le bon prestataire : Recherchez l'expérience, les références, la transparence des tarifs et demandez des exemples de rapports.
- Questions à poser : Demandez des exemples de rapports, renseignez-vous sur les méthodes et assurez-vous qu'il comprend vos besoins spécifiques.
Réaliser un audit soi-même
Effectuer un audit vous-même est une option intéressante si vous possédez des compétences techniques et désirez économiser. Cependant, cela demande du temps, des efforts et une connaissance des outils et techniques.
- Outils gratuits et payants : Google PageSpeed Insights, GTmetrix, WebPageTest (performance) ; Google Search Console, SEMrush (SEO) ; OWASP ZAP, Nessus (sécurité) ; WAVE, axe DevTools (accessibilité).
- Guide étape par étape :
- Définir les objectifs de l'audit.
- Collecter les données via les outils.
- Analyser les résultats obtenus.
- Prioriser les problèmes détectés.
- Élaborer un plan d'action concret.
- Mettre en œuvre les correctifs nécessaires.
- Suivre et mesurer l'impact des améliorations.
L'importance de la documentation
Conservez un historique de l'audit, des problèmes et des corrections. Une documentation facilite le suivi et la comparaison des audits successifs.
La fréquence des audits
La fréquence des audits dépend de la taille et complexité de votre site. Pour les petits sites, un audit annuel suffit. Pour les grands sites ou e-commerces, un audit trimestriel ou semestriel est préférable.
Le suivi : une étape clé pour l'amélioration du site web
L'audit technique n'est pas une action isolée, mais un processus continu qui nécessite un suivi régulier et une amélioration permanente. Après l'audit et la résolution des problèmes, il est essentiel de mettre en place un système de suivi pour observer en temps réel la performance, la sécurité et l'accessibilité de votre site. Pour garantir une protection continue, il est également crucial de sensibiliser vos équipes aux bonnes pratiques de sécurité et de développement web. Organisez des sessions de formation régulières pour les informer des dernières menaces et des techniques pour les contrer.
- Mise en place d'un système de monitoring : Des outils comme Google Analytics, New Relic et Sentry sont à utiliser pour la surveillance.
- Intégration des résultats dans la stratégie : Exploitez les données de l'audit pour améliorer la performance, le SEO, la sécurité et l'UX.
- Formation continue : Restez informé des technologies et des meilleures pratiques en développement et sécurité web.
- Tests A/B : Expérimentez différentes solutions pour optimiser la performance et la conversion.
- L'importance de l'itération : Améliorez continuellement votre site en fonction des résultats du suivi et des tests A/B.
Un site web performant : la clé du succès en ligne
Un audit technique régulier est un investissement essentiel pour la pérennité de votre site. En corrigeant les faiblesses avant qu'elles ne causent des pertes financières, de réputation et de trafic, vous garantissez que votre site reste un atout précieux. Agissez et investissez dans la santé de votre site, car un site performant est la clé de la réussite sur le web. Pensez à réaliser un audit technique de votre site web dès aujourd'hui. Contactez un expert ou utilisez les outils mentionnés dans cet article pour identifier les points à améliorer et optimiser votre présence en ligne.